Samuel Benveniste is a scholar working on Demography, Cognitive Neuroscience and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Samuel Benveniste has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 424 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Demography, 3 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 3 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Samuel Benveniste’s work include Technology Use by Older Adults (4 papers), Dementia and Cognitive Impairment Research (3 papers) and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(2 papers). Samuel Benveniste is often cited by papers focused on Technology Use by Older Adults (4 papers), Dementia and Cognitive Impairment Research (3 papers) and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(2 papers). Samuel Benveniste collaborates with scholars based in France, Chile and United Kingdom. Samuel Benveniste's co-authors include Pierre Jouvelot, Anne‐Sophie Rigaud, Maribel Pino, Mélodie Boulay, Sergio L. Vargas, René López, Juan Antonio Vargas, Marta Colombo, Walter T. Hughes and Sebastián Donoso and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, The Journal of Infectious Diseases and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
